200 families lose homes in Port Area fire

MANILA, Philippines - About 200 families were left homeless in an hour-long fire that hit Port Area, Manila yesterday.

The fire, which started at around 9:45 a.m., razed more than 100 houses and stalls selling secondhand appliances along Roberto Oca street before it was put out by 10:30 a.m.

No one was hurt in the fire, which reached Task Force Alpha, the highest of a five-level alert that means available firetrucks in the metropolis should respond.

Authorities have yet to establish the cause of the fire and the property damage incurred.
